Rajawali Bercerita: “I Want to Tell a Story Too”

rajawali-bercerita“Who wants to hear a story?” asked Kak Dito. “I do… I do… I do…” shouted the children. That morning (2/12), Sanggar Fortune 1 located in Pondok Pinang received a visit from Rajawali Group. This time, Kak Satrio Anindito got the turn to tell a story. With his witty style, as he was telling a story titled Waktunya Cepuk Terbang (Time for the Little Box to Fly), Kak Dito invited the children to imitate a flying box to stimulate their motor. Not to be outdone by Kak Dito, one of the students also showed off her skill in reading another story book titled Petualangan Sekeping Kancing (The Adventure of a Piece of Button) to her friends. “Very exciting. I also love reading books at home “, said Amel after reading the story.

“Hopefully parents at home would also apply this method to the children regularly in order to increase their interest in reading,” said Kak Dito after reading the story. Rajawali Bercerita is a form of Rajawali Group’s concern for education in the country, especially Early Childhood Education (PAUD). Based on a research conducted with partners, Rajawali Group found out that Indonesian early childhood education is still in need of proper learning media. The books for early childhood education are still very difficult to find. In the end of the event, Rajawali Group presented a number of storybooks for children of early age to PAUD teachers of Sanggar Fortune. Rajawali Bercerita program and storybooks distribution will still be conducted in all PAUDs fostered by Sanggar Fortune in December 2015.
